From theoretical calculations, it has been shown that the O-S=O and O=S-O contribute more (are more important/stable) than the O=S=O form, and the d orbitals are not heavily involved in the SO bonds. There are two different geometries: electron pair geometry looks at all the arrangement of all the electron pairs and molecule geometry or shape just looks at the arrangement of the bonded atoms. The dot structure for sulfur dioxide has sulfur with a double bond to an oxygen on the left, and two lone pairs of electrons on that oxygen, and the sulfur with a double bond to an oxygen on the right, and two lone pairs of electrons on that oxygen.
